Birth Certificates in Willard

Willard residents request birth certificates from the Huron County Clerk of Court in Norwalk, approximately 14 miles northeast of the city. Local children are often born at Fisher-Titus Medical Center in Norwalk or Mercy Hospital in Willard before families establish homes in neighborhoods near Central Park or along Myrtle Avenue. Huron County has maintained thorough birth records for decades, providing reliable documentation for residents throughout southwestern areas of the county. The current fee structure includes $25 for the first certified copy and $20 for each additional copy requested simultaneously.

Who Can Request

The person named on the certificate, their parent/legal guardian, spouse, child, grandparent, sibling, or authorized legal representative with proper documentation.

Marriage Licenses in Willard

Couples planning weddings in Willard’s charming venues such as Central Park’s gazebo, historic churches along Emerald Street, or private celebrations at local community centers must obtain licenses from the Huron County Clerk of Court in Norwalk. Ohio requires no mandatory waiting period, allowing immediate ceremonies after license issuance. How to Order in Willard

Visit the Huron County Clerk of Court at 2 E Main St #207 in Norwalk, about 20 minutes from downtown Willard via State Route 18. Office hours are Monday through Friday 8:00 AM to 4:30 PM. Free street parking is typically available along Main Street and nearby side streets in downtown Norwalk. The office accepts cash, checks, and major credit cards for payment. From Willard, take Benedict Avenue north to SR-18 east, then follow signs to downtown Norwalk courthouse square.

Do I have to drive to Norwalk from Willard for certificates?

Yes, Huron County vital records are processed exclusively through the Clerk of Court office in Norwalk at 2 E Main St. The drive from Willard takes about 20 minutes via State Route 18 east, and the courthouse is located in downtown Norwalk near the historic courthouse square.

Can I mail my certificate request from Willard?

Yes, the Huron County Clerk of Court accepts mail-in requests for vital records. Willard residents can mail completed applications with proper identification copies and payment to 2 E Main St #207, Norwalk, OH 44857. Processing time for mail requests is typically 5-7 business days.

What’s the fastest way to get certificates if I live in Willard?

The fastest service is visiting the Huron County Clerk of Court office in person in Norwalk. Most requests can be processed same-day during business hours. From Willard, the drive takes about 20 minutes via SR-18 east to downtown Norwalk.

Are there any satellite offices closer to Willard?

No, the Huron County Clerk of Court in Norwalk is the only authorized location for official vital records serving Willard residents. However, the office is easily accessible from Willard via State Route 18, and free parking is available in downtown Norwalk.

What are the office hours for Huron County vital records?

The Huron County Clerk of Court in Norwalk operates Monday through Friday from 8:00 AM to 4:30 PM. Willard residents should plan to arrive at least 30 minutes before closing to ensure service, especially for complex requests or multiple documents.
